150 kV submarine export cable system for the 330 MW Kafireas II wind farm, comprising roughly 70 km of subsea route between Evia and the Lavrion area plus 11 km of onshore cable to the IPTO 150 kV substation.
Tekmar Energy received a subcontract from Hellenic Cables to design, manufacture and supply bend restrictor cable protection systems for the Kafireas II export cable. The protection systems are engineered to safeguard approximately 70 km of 150 kV subsea power cable that connects the 330 MW Kafireas II wind farm on Evia Island to mainland Greece. Tekmar produces the bend restrictors at its Newton Aycliffe facility in northeast England, with delivery scheduled for the third quarter of 2021, supporting safe installation and long-term mechanical integrity of the submarine interconnection.
